Why This New Ad Format Matters to Law Firms
Thought leadership is essential for building trust and credibility in the legal profession. Lawyers routinely produce articles, whitepapers and insightful commentary aimed at showcasing expertise. However, traditionally promoting this content through standard ad platforms often raises ethical red flags around misrepresentation and solicitation.
LinkedIn’s Thought Leadership Ads offer an ideal balance. By clearly identifying content as sponsored thought leadership rather than direct solicitation, these ads mitigate ethical concerns and boost the visibility of a firm's intellectual contributions without crossing Rule 7.1’s prohibitions against misleading communications.
According to a recent survey by Greentarget, nearly 77% of legal decision makers utilize thought leadership as a significant factor when selecting outside counsel. Clearly, amplifying high-quality thought leadership can be strategically advantageous.

Privacy-Safe ABM Uploads
Account-Based Marketing (ABM) enables firms to securely upload hashed email lists to LinkedIn. This privacy-preserving method ensures compliance with confidentiality obligations, adhering strictly to privacy regulations such as GDPR and CCPA. LinkedIn’s secure matching prevents exposure of confidential client data, ensuring ethical peace of mind.
Creative Checklist: Quote, Stat, Safe CTA
Optimizing ad creative involves three key components:
- Quote: Feature direct insights from reputable partners or clients.
- Statistic: Include data-driven statements from credible, third-party sources.
- Safe CTA: Utilize calls-to-action that encourage learning or downloading content, rather than direct solicitation.

30-Day Pilot Plan
To capitalize quickly and ethically on LinkedIn’s Thought Leadership Ads, consider implementing a focused 30-day pilot:
- Week 1: Identify top-performing thought-leadership assets and compliance check.
- Week 2: Target audience segmentation and ABM list prep.
- Week 3: Creative ad production, adhering to ethical guidelines.
- Week 4: Launch, monitor, and optimize performance based on real-time insights.
